Stone garden installation services involve the placement and arrangement of natural or manufactured stones to create visually appealing and functional outdoor spaces. This process typically includes designing pathways, patios, retaining walls, or decorative features that enhance the overall look and usability of a property. Skilled contractors work with a variety of stone materials, ensuring proper foundation preparation, precise placement, and secure setting to produce durable and attractive results. These services can transform plain yards into inviting outdoor areas suitable for relaxing, entertaining, or adding curb appeal.
Many property owners turn to stone garden installation to address common landscape challenges. For instance, uneven or muddy ground can be stabilized with stone features that provide solid, slip-resistant surfaces. Retaining walls built with stone can help manage soil erosion and create level areas on sloped terrain. Additionally, incorporating stone elements can reduce ongoing maintenance by preventing weed growth and minimizing the need for frequent repairs. These installations not only solve practical problems but also add a timeless aesthetic that can increase the value of a home.

The overview below groups typical Stone Garden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chesterfield,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stone garden repairs, such as replacing a few stones or fixing small sections, usually range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work.
Mid-Range Installations - Installing a new stone garden or extending an existing one generally costs between $1,500-$3,000. Larger, more detailed projects can push beyond this range, but most projects stay within this band.
Full Garden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an entire stone garden often costs from $4,000-$8,000, depending on size and complexity. Fewer projects reach into the highest tiers unless they involve extensive customization or large areas.
Custom and Complex Projects - Highly detailed or custom-designed stone gardens can exceed $10,000, especially for large or intricate features.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ized work by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are a key factor when evaluating service providers. A reputable contractor should be able to provide a detailed scope of work, including the materials to be used, the process for preparing the site, and the steps involved in completing the project.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also beneficial to discuss any warranties or guarantees offered, as these can provide additional confidence in the contractor’s commitment to quality work.

What types of stone are used in garden installations? Local contractors can work with a variety of stones such as flagstone, granite, limestone, and slate to suit different garden styles and preferences.
Can stone gardens be customized to fit specific yard sizes? Yes, service providers can design and install stone gardens tailored to the dimensions and layout of individual yards in Chesterfield, VA.
Are there different styles of stone garden layouts available? Contractors offer various styles, including formal, naturalistic, and contemporary designs, to match the aesthetic of the outdoor space.
What are common features included in stone garden installations? Features often include pathways, retaining walls, decorative borders, and seating areas, depending on the project scope.
